§ 94.56 SIDEWALKS AND CULVERTS CONSTRUCTED WITHIN PUBLIC RIGHTS-OF-WAY TO CONFORM TO SPECIFICATIONS.
   (A)   All sidewalks constructed, maintained, repaired, and reconstructed upon and within any public right-of-way within the city shall be constructed, maintained, repaired, and reconstructed according to the sidewalk specifications of the regulations for subdivisions adopted by the County and Municipal Planning and Zoning Commission pursuant to KRS Chapter 100.
   (B)   All culverts constructed, maintained, repaired, and reconstructed upon and within any public right-of-way within the city shall be constructed, maintained, repaired, and reconstructed so that the drain thereof is at least eight inches in diameter, and open and unobstructed throughout the width and length thereof.
